Here are some parenting tips and advice to help you navigate the shopping experience with ease: 1. Plan Ahead: Before embarking on your shopping trip, take some time to plan out your route and list of items you need to buy. This will not only help you save time but also keep your little ones engaged and focused during the trip. 2. Choose Family-Friendly Stores: Opt for stores that cater to families with amenities such as kids' play areas, family restrooms, and child-friendly shopping carts. Many malls in Dubai and Abu Dhabi offer these facilities to make your shopping experience more convenient. 3. Keep Snacks and Toys Handy: Pack some snacks and a few favorite toys to keep your children entertained while you browse through the aisles. This will not only keep them occupied but also prevent any meltdowns due to boredom. 4. Engage Your Kids: Involve your children in the shopping process by assigning them small tasks like picking out fruits or selecting items from the shelves. This will make them feel included and help them learn valuable skills. 5. Set Expectations: Communicate clear rules and expectations before heading into the store. Let your children know what behavior is acceptable and what is not. Praise them for good behavior and address any misbehavior calmly and firmly. 6. Take Breaks: Allow for breaks during your shopping trip to give your children a chance to stretch their legs and burn off some energy. Consider visiting a nearby play area or enjoying a snack together to break up the shopping routine. 7. Be Patient and Flexible: Above all, remember to stay patient and flexible. Shopping with children can be unpredictable, so be prepared to adapt to changing circumstances and handle any challenges with grace and humor.
